At No. 7 Arizona 73, Stanford 66: Mark Lyons scored a season-high 25 points and led a key stretch in the second half, helping the No. 7 Wildcats (20-2 overall, 9-2 Pacific-12) hold off the Cardinal (14-9, 5-5).

Solomon Hill added 23 points and Angelo Chol gave Arizona a lift grabbing eight rebounds.

At Oregon State 82, Utah 64: Roberto Nelson had 26 points and five rebounds, and the Beavers (12-11, 2- Pacific-12) pulled away from the Utes (10-12, 2-8) in the second half.

Joe Burton added 17 points, seven rebounds and 10 assists for Oregon State, which recorded its highest point total in a conference game this season.
